調子に乗る is an exact match with the following word:
調子に乗る
BOOST
Reading : ちょうしにのる   
expression, 'ru' godan verb
1. to be elated; to be excited; to be caught up in the moment; to be carried away; to get cocky
2. to get up to speed; to move into gear
